is the third installment of the popular Indian crime-thriller franchise on ZEE5 , premiering on July 29, 2022 . This six-episode season moves its focus to the volatile political landscape of Bihar between the late 1980s and 2010. Plot & Inspiration

As Haroon's influence grows, it challenges the established political order. The story progresses into a high-stakes chess game involving rival gangs, betrayed allies, and determined state authorities. The "Darr Ki Rajneeti" (Politics of Fear) subtitle serves as the perfect summary for the plot, illustrating how fear is weaponised as a legitimate currency to win elections and control administrative machinery. Shahabuddin was a former Member of Parliament from Siwan, Bihar, who was infamous for being a "bahubali" (strongman) politician. He was convicted for multiple murders, extortion, and kidnappings, and was often described by the media as a "gangster-politician" who ran a parallel reign of terror in the region. Reports suggest he was so powerful that he could run his criminal operations even from inside jail.
: The story is loosely inspired by the life of Mohammad Shahabuddin , a controversial former MP from Siwan, Bihar, known as a "bahubali" (strongman).
